Course Details

• Introduction to Media Innovation Regulation
• Digital Rights and Online Freedom of Expression
• Media Convergence and Regulatory Challenges
• Privacy, Data Protection, and Media Innovation
• Net Neutrality and its Impact on Media Landscape
• Regulating Social Media and User-Generated Content
• International Media Law and its Influence on Domestic Regulations
• Ethical Considerations in Media Innovation Regulation
• Case Studies on Media Innovation Regulation
• Future of Media Innovation Regulation and Policy Trends
